Just play the game and learn as you go along. Use the in game tutorials to familiarise yourself with the menus and navigation and look things up if you get stuck or confused. Don't worry too much about results on your first few saves and enjoy the learning curve.

I personally don't recommend watching reams of YouTube videos and tutorials, as with a game like FM, doing is a much better way to learn than watching someone else do it, which is quite frankly, pretty boring IMO.
